What's The Definition Of Stoic?

stoic
adjective: Stoic means the same as stoical.

Stoic in American English
adjective: of or pertaining to the school of philosophy founded by Zeno, who taught that people should be free from passion, unmoved by joy or grief, and submit without complaint to unavoidable necessity
noun: a member or adherent of the Stoic school of philosophy

Stoic in British English
adjective
adjective: of or relating to the doctrines of the Stoics
noun: a member of the ancient Greek school of philosophy founded by Zeno of Citium, holding that virtue and happiness can be attained only by submission to destiny and the natural law
noun: a person who maintains stoical qualities
